Investigation of the primary breakup length and instability of non-Newtonian viscoelastic liquid jets
The temporal instability and primary breakup length of a non-Newtonian viscoelastic liquid jet moving in an inviscid gaseous environment were carried out by solving a set of linearized Navier-Stokes equations and employing the linear viscoelastic model, respectively.
